Ingredients
. 1½ cups packed light brown sugar
. 1 cup unsalted butter, melted, slightly cooled
. 2 large egg yolks
. 1½ tsp. vanilla extract
. ⅔ cup unsweetened Dutch process cocoa powder
. 1 tsp. baking soda
. 1 tsp. kosher salt
. 2 tsp. red gel food coloring
. 2 cups all-purpose flour
. ½ cup red sanding sugar
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350 degrees and arrange the racks in the upper and lower thirds of the oven.
- In a large bowl, whisk the brown sugar and melted butter together until the mixture lightens in color, about 30 seconds.
- Add in the egg yolks and vanilla extract, whisking until fully incorporated.
- Gradually incorporate the c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t while whisking to combine.
- Stir in the red gel food coloring until the batter is fully blended.
- Gently fold in the all-purpose flour until just combined, being careful not to overmix.
- Roll the dough into 16 equal balls and coat them in the red sanding sugar.
- Arrange the dough balls on parchment-lined baking sheets, spaced 2 inches apart for even baking.
- Bake for 12 to 14 minutes, rotating the sheets halfway through, until the cookies are puffed and their tops begin to crack.
-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heets for 5 minutes before transferring them to wire racks to cool completely.

Top Tips for Perfecting Sparkly Red Velvet Cookies
- Use Gel Food Coloring: It delivers a vibrant color without altering the batter’s consistency.
- Measure Ingredients Accurately: Baking is a science, so make sure to measure your flour properly for the best texture.
- Don’t Overmix: When folding in the flour, mix until just combined to keep your cookies light and tender.
- Rotate Your Pan: If your oven has hot spots, rotating the pans halfway through baking helps ensure even cooking.
- Cool Before Storing: Allow cookies to cool completely before adding them to storage to avoid sogginess.
- Chill the Dough: If the dough seems too soft to handle, refrigerate it for 15-30 minutes before forming balls.
- Experiment with Toppings: Feel free to add chocolate chips or nuts to the dough for an extra touch of flavor and texture!
Storing and Reheating Tips
To keep your Sparkly Red Velvet C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ay delicious for about a week. If you want to keep them longer, you can freeze them by placing them in a freezer-safe container. Just make sure to separate layers with parchment paper. To enjoy them after freezing, simply thaw at room temperature or pop them in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ds.

FAQs
What’s the difference between red velvet cookies and red velvet cake?
Red velvet cookies maintain the same delicious cocoa and vanilla flavors as the cake but are denser and have a chewy texture, making them a perfect handheld treat.
Can I use regular food coloring instead of gel?
While you can, gel food coloring yields a more vibrant color without affecting the cookie’s consistency as much as liquid food coloring does.
What can I add to customize my red velvet cookies?
You can fold in chocolate chips, walnuts, or even cream cheese pieces for a delightful spin on the classic cookie!
